Two Volvo Trucks carriers, Producers Dairy order VNR electric trucks

Green Car Congress

The Volvo VNR Electric’s 264-kWh lithium-ion batteries have an operating range of up to 150 miles. Watsontown Trucking Company operates a fleet of 425 trucks that perform over-the-road transport, as well as regional haul and last-mile delivery—two applications that the Volvo VNR Electric model was designed to support.

Electrify America to install 2,800 charging stations at workplaces and multi-unit dwellings across US

Green Car Congress

Electrify America LLC announced it will install more than 2,800 workplace and residential charging stations by June 2019 in 17 of the biggest metropolitan areas in the United States. The companies have committed to install 35% of all multi-family and workplace sites in California in designated low-income or disadvantaged community areas.

Project to award up to $15.5M in rebates for EV chargers in Sacramento County

Green Car Congress

The rebates will be available through the Sacramento County Incentive Project to install both commercial-grade Level 2 chargers and high-powered DC fast chargers. California’s goal is to get 5 million EVs on its roads by 2030 to reduce carbon emissions and to support those vehicles by installing 250,000 chargers statewide.

Up to $29M available for public EV chargers in SoCal; SCIP accepting applications

Green Car Congress

Up to $29 million is now available through the Southern California Incentive Project ( SCIP ) to install charging stations in the four-county area. California aims to get 5 million EVs on its roads by 2030 and to install 250,000 vehicle charging stations to support those vehicles.

Electrify America opening first California EV fast charging station in Torrance; targeting 9 in California by year-end

Green Car Congress

The Country Hills Shopping Plaza in Torrance, California will be the site of the first DC fast charging station to open in the state as part of Electrify America’s plan to install approximately 160 charging stations in California by June 2019. Within California, average distance between stations is projected to be 48 miles.
